Dude sorry to hear about the bad luck! I know it probably goes without saying but did you make sure the electronic parking brake wasn't pulled at the time? Were you making sure to hold the brake all the way down while pulling the gear selector? Also something I've noticed on this car that I've never had with any of my past vehicles, is that when the car is in park but on any kind of incline, when you go to put it into drive or reverse, sometimes it acts funky and will automatically apply the brakes for you like it's assuming it's rolling without your permission. I think this happens if you try to take your foot off the brake to suddenly after putting it into gear. When this happens it can be very jarring and almost feel as though the vehicle shuts off. I also always turn the Auto on/Auto Off feature off completely when I hop into the car. Something else I found out over the weekend, and this could be just my experience, is that when you're in manual shift mode, you can't use the gear selector to put the car into reverse. You have to bump the shifter back into automatic drive mode to get to reverse. I found this kind of odd. Anyways, hope everything works out and you have no more issues!
